Why Festival Season Is the Best Time to Launch a Book in India
Festival season in India is built around gifting, and books are one of the easiest, most personal gifts to give, which puts your launch directly in front of buyers already in a giving mindset.
Retailers and platforms lean into the season too, running festive promotions and dedicated gifting pages that a quiet-month release simply does not get for free.
Here is what makes this window different from the rest of the year:
- Higher discretionary spending on gifts, including books, in the weeks leading up to Diwali and Navratri.
- Increased footfall at bookstores, temple stalls, and pop-up stands during festival fairs and community events.
- Amazon and other platforms run festive sales events that boost visibility for new listings timed just before them.
- Family gatherings and travel during festivals create natural word-of-mouth moments for gift-worthy books.
- Media and local press actively look for festive human-interest stories, making authors more pitch-worthy during this window.

Which Festivals Matter Most for Book Launches?
Diwali remains the single biggest gifting occasion in the Indian calendar, and a launch timed two to three weeks before it captures the heaviest wave of gift shopping.
Navratri and the festive weeks around it work especially well for devotional and spiritual titles, since readers are already seeking religious and reflective content during this period.
Raksha Bandhan and Ganesh Chaturthi offer smaller but still meaningful windows, particularly for children’s books, illustrated titles, and regional-language releases.

How Festival-Season Sales Compare to the Rest of the Year
| Book sales in India consistently rise in the weeks around Diwali and Navratri, with the sharpest gains in gift-friendly categories such as devotional titles, children’s books, and illustrated non-fiction. |
Here is how the major festivals break down by genre fit and why each one works:
| Festival | Best-Fit Genres | Why It Works |
| Diwali | Devotional, self-help, illustrated non-fiction | Peak gifting season across all age groups |
| Navratri | Devotional, spiritual, mythology | Directly aligned with the festival’s religious themes |
| Raksha Bandhan | Children’s books, poetry | Sibling gifting occasion, lighter price points work well |
| Ganesh Chaturthi | Devotional, regional-language titles | Strong regional and community-level engagement |
What Makes Festival Timing Especially Powerful for Devotional and Gift Books?
Devotional and spiritual books benefit most from festival timing, since the book’s subject matter and the season’s mood reinforce each other directly.
Illustrated and gift-format books also perform well, since festival buyers are often shopping for someone else and respond strongly to visual presentation on the shelf or listing page. How to Plan a Book Launch Around Festival Season
A festival launch works best when it is planned backwards from the festival date, not forward from whenever your manuscript happens to be ready.
- Start your production timeline eight to ten weeks before the festival, covering editing, cover design, printing, and listing setup.
- Design a cover and format that feels gift-appropriate, since festival buyers are often purchasing the book for someone else.
- Reach out to local bookstores, temple stalls, and festival fairs early to secure shelf space or a stall before the season gets busy.
- Pitch local press and community publications with a festive angle, such as a personal story tied to the festival or the book’s theme.
- Run festival-timed ads on Amazon and Meta, using festive keywords and gifting-focused creative in the two weeks before the festival.

How Early Should You Start Planning?
Ideally, planning should begin ten to twelve weeks before the festival, since printing and distribution timelines leave little room for delays once the season starts.
Authors who start later can still launch in time, but should prioritise digital formats and pre-orders over physical stock, which takes longer to secure.
